By Jonathan Underhill Nov. 3 (BusinessDesk) - The New Zealand dollar gained to a two-week high against the pound after the Bank of England raised interest rates for the first time in more than 10 years but said further hikes would be gradual, a more dovish view than the market was expecting. The kiwi rose to 52.94 British pence as at 8am in Wellington from 52.10 pence late yesterday.
